Factors to Consider When Choosing Noisecanceling Headsets For Gaming

Choosing the right noisecanceling headset for gaming involves weighing several factors beyond just noise cancellation. Understanding your gaming environment, preferred sound profile, and comfort needs can help narrow your options. Additionally, features like microphone quality, wireless vs. wired connectivity, and battery life play vital roles in your overall experience. In this guide, I’ll walk through key considerations to help you evaluate which headset aligns best with your gaming style and setup.

Noise Cancellation Effectiveness

Effective active noise cancellation (ANC) is essential for creating an immersive gaming experience, especially in noisy environments. Some headsets use advanced algorithms to block out background noise, allowing you to focus solely on game audio. However, more aggressive ANC can sometimes cause audio artifacts or increase the headset’s weight and cost. Consider how much external noise you typically encounter and whether the headset’s ANC can handle that level of disturbance without compromising sound quality.

Sound Quality and Surround Sound

Good sound quality, including surround sound capabilities, makes a significant difference in gaming, providing spatial awareness for better reactions. Look for headsets with high-quality drivers and virtual surround sound features if you want an edge in competitive play. Remember, some models emphasize bass or clarity more, so choose based on your preferred sound profile and the type of games you play most often.

Comfort and Fit

Long gaming sessions demand a comfortable fit. Features like adjustable headbands, plush ear cushions, and lightweight designs help reduce fatigue. Wireless headsets often add weight due to batteries, so test or read reviews about comfort over extended periods. If you’re prone to ear fatigue or have sensitive skin, prioritize models with breathable materials and ergonomic design.

Battery Life and Connectivity

Wireless headsets offer freedom of movement but require reliable battery life. Some models provide over 20 hours of continuous use, which is ideal for marathon gaming sessions, while others may need frequent recharging. Connectivity options—such as Bluetooth, 2.4GHz wireless, or wired—also influence compatibility and latency. Decide if you prefer the convenience of wireless or the reliability of wired connections for competitive play.

Microphone Quality and Additional Features

A clear, noise-canceling microphone enhances communication with teammates. Look for models with adjustable, flip-up, or boom microphones that minimize background noise. Additional features like RGB lighting, customizable controls, or app integration can add to the experience but may also increase cost or weight. Prioritize features that align with your gaming environment and personal preferences.

Frequently Asked Questions

Will active noise cancellation drain my headset’s battery quickly?

Yes, active noise cancellation typically consumes more power, which can reduce overall battery life. However, many high-quality headsets balance this with efficient power management, allowing several hours of use on a single charge. If you play for extended periods, consider a model with a large battery capacity or options to disable ANC when not needed.

Can I use a noisecanceling gaming headset for other activities?

Absolutely. Many noisecanceling headsets are versatile enough for music, movies, and work calls. However, features like the microphone quality or surround sound may be optimized for gaming, so if you’re using it for other purposes, check the specific features to ensure they meet your needs.

Is wireless connectivity as reliable as wired for competitive gaming?

Modern wireless headsets offer low latency and stable connections, making them suitable for competitive play. Look for headsets with high-quality 2.4GHz or Bluetooth 5.3 connections, which minimize lag. However, wired connections still provide the most reliable and latency-free experience, especially in fast-paced games.

How important is microphone quality in a noisecanceling headset?

Microphone quality is critical for clear communication, particularly in team-based games. Noise-canceling microphones help reduce background sounds, ensuring your voice comes through loud and clear. If you often communicate during gameplay, prioritize models with adjustable, high-quality mics that can be positioned optimally.

Should I prioritize sound quality or noise cancellation?

Both are important, but the priority depends on your environment. If you game in noisy places, effective noise cancellation enhances immersion. If you’re in a quiet setting, focus more on sound quality and surround sound features. Ideally, choose a headset that offers a good balance of both for the best overall gaming experience.
